HP OfficeJet 4658 All-in-One Printer
Microsoft Windows 10 (64-bit)

Hi,

my hp officejet 4658 is not recognizing the empty/damaged black ink, as it sill shows on its screen that the cartridge is not empty. But when I try to print with it, no black color is being printed. When I print the report page, the indicator for the black ink shows that it is empty. I have tried all the cleaning options and followed all the instruction from the virtual agent, but nothing seems to be working. I don't think that the cartridge is dried because I was using it fairly regularly  and this actually happened abruptly.

Can you please help me with this issue?

I understand the black ink cartridge is not working. I appreciate your efforts in trying to resolve this issue by performing the necessary troubleshooting steps.

 

Check if the ink cartridges are properly inserted in the printer, you may refer to - Replace HP inkjet printer cartridges

 

Kindly perform the steps mentioned in this document - Ink cartridge error

 

Insert the old/alternate ink cartridge(if available) and check if the error persists. If not, then the new one is defective.
